two.1.4) Short description
Housing Services Review
Sheffield City Council (SCC) is undertaking an ambitious and significant programme of change known as the Place Systems Review. The scope of the first phase of the programme involves reviewing all associated business processes and ICT systems end-to-end for all Housing Services delivered by Sheffield City Council. This initial phase of the programme is a discovery phase via a soft market test exercise to explore the opportunities available in the market. The insight gained from the soft market test will be used to assist with refining our requirements and will inform any future procurement activity. Follow the link through to the advert on ProContract for more information. An event is scheduled for 1st February 2021 and the soft market test documents will be published towards that date.
